How to create a new email account on your Email Only Hosting Package

This guide will walk you through the process of creating a new email account on your Email Only Hosting Package

  1. Log into your Client Services Area.

  2. Click on the Services icon.
    Absolute Hosting Client Services Area

  3. Click on the Active button for your Email Only Hosting package.
    Absolute Hosting - Email Only Hosting
  4. On the Manage Product page, scroll down to the Email Management Section and click the Email Accounts icon
    Email Only Hosting - Create Email Accounts
  5. On the Email Accounts page, click the Create Account button.
    Email only hosting create new email account
  6. Enter in the new email account name + password on the Create Account modal window along with any limits and click Create
    Create new email only hosting account with limits

You can now log into the new email account via webmail or setup your mail application to connect to the email account on the server that hosts your Email Only Hosting Package
